Transaction 843f15101fc13a0b7453818fed95aa6355b044ea9685e3732a8cef5a44283388
1 Input
1 Output
-
843f15101fc13a0b7453818fed95aa6355b044ea9685e3732a8cef5a44283388:0
- value
- 31705249
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be69dd11cdfe4616156a4918fc7f0755daf32faa OP_EQUAL
- address
- 3K3q8X81cFh6cCCUsLqj8yz29WVYvGDk68